Formula

rontonewtons = hectonewtons × 1e+29

This factor comes from each unit's defined relationship to the category's base unit: 1 hectonewton equals 100 base units, and 1 rontonewton equals 1e-27 base units, so dividing one by the other gives the direct hectonewton-to-rontonewton factor of 1e+29.
